The allure of a simple yet captivating game has endured for generations, and few exemplify this quite like the plinko game. Originating as a key component of the popular television show "The Price Is Right," the game quickly transcended its television origins to become a beloved form of entertainment in its own right. The core concept is remarkably straightforward: a disc is dropped from a height, cascading down a board studded with pegs, and eventually landing in a designated slot at the bottom, each slot corresponding to a varying prize value. It's a spectacle of chance, where anticipation builds with every bounce and unpredictable trajectory.

Understanding the Physics of the Plinko Board

The seemingly random nature of the plinko game belies a fascinating interplay of physics. The trajectory of the disc is governed by gravity, but is significantly influenced by the strategically placed pegs. Each peg represents a point of potential deflection, altering the disc’s path and ultimately determining its final destination. The arrangement of these pegs—their density, angle, and positioning—therefore plays a critical role in shaping the probability distribution of outcomes. A higher density of pegs will generally result in more erratic travel, while a sparser arrangement could allow for more predictable, and potentially directional, movement. Understanding these dynamics is crucial for anyone looking to analyze and potentially influence the game's outcome, though true randomness remains a core aspect.

The Role of Friction and Disc Material

Beyond gravity and peg deflection, other factors contribute to the game's behavior. Friction between the disc and the board surface, and even the material composition of the disc itself, can introduce subtle variations in the trajectory. A disc with a rougher surface might experience greater friction, slowing its descent and altering its bounce angles. Conversely, a smoother disc will glide more easily, potentially traveling further and exhibiting less deflection. These seemingly minor variables can accumulate over the course of the descent, contributing to the inherent unpredictability of the game. Analyzing the coefficient of friction between the disc and the board could illuminate these often overlooked influences.

The Psychology of Plinko: Why It’s So Addictive

The enduring appeal of the plinko game extends beyond its simple mechanics. The game taps into fundamental psychological principles that make it exceptionally engaging and even addictive. The variable reward schedule, where the value of each slot varies, is a key factor. This unpredictability triggers the release of dopamine, a neurotransmitter associated with pleasure and reward, creating a compelling feedback loop. Each drop feels like a new opportunity, a fresh chance to win big, and the anticipation can be incredibly stimulating. This constant potential for reward keeps players coming back for more, even in the face of frequent losses. The excitement is reinforced with each attempt.

The Near-Miss Effect and Cognitive Bias

Furthermore, the “near-miss” effect contributes to the game’s addictive nature. When the disc lands close to a high-value slot, the player experiences a sense of frustration, but also a heightened expectation for the next attempt. This near-miss reinforces the belief that a big win is just around the corner, perpetuating the cycle of play. Cognitive biases, such as the illusion of control—the tendency to overestimate one’s ability to influence random events—also play a role. Players may convince themselves that they can subtly manipulate the outcome through their drop technique, even though the game is fundamentally based on chance. These psychological factors explain why the plinko game can be so captivating and difficult to resist.

Plinko in the Digital Age: Online Adaptations

The transition from physical game show staple to digital entertainment has been remarkably smooth for the plinko game. Online versions of the game have proliferated across various platforms, offering players the chance to experience the thrill of the drop from the comfort of their own homes. These digital adaptations often incorporate additional features, such as enhanced graphics, sound effects, and varying prize structures, to enhance the gaming experience. Some platforms even offer multiplayer modes, allowing players to compete against each other in real-time. The convenience and accessibility of online plinko games have broadened their appeal to a wider audience.

One significant shift in the digital realm is the integration of the plinko mechanic into the world of cryptocurrency and blockchain gaming. Several platforms now offer plinko-style games with the potential to win real cryptocurrency prizes. These platforms often utilize provably fair algorithms, ensuring transparency and trust in the game’s randomness. This innovative application of the plinko concept has attracted a new generation of players interested in decentralized gaming and the potential for financial rewards. Beyond Entertainment: Educational Applications and Skill Development

While primarily known for its entertainment value, the core principles behind the plinko game can be leveraged for educational purposes. The game demonstrates fundamental concepts in physics, such as gravity, projectile motion, and probability. It can be used as a visual aid to illustrate these concepts in a practical and engaging manner, particularly for students learning about these topics for the first time. Building a simplified plinko board with students can foster hands-on learning and encourage experimentation. Moreover, the game indirectly promotes decision-making skills and risk assessment. Players must weigh the potential rewards against the inherent risks, making a judgment call with each drop.

Consider a school science project where students design and build their own plinko boards, experimenting with different peg arrangements and materials to observe the impact on the outcome. Such an exercise not only reinforces scientific principles but also encourages creativity and problem-solving skills. Furthermore, the data collected from these experiments can be analyzed statistically, introducing students to basic data analysis techniques.
